The postcode CB22 3EQ is located in South Cambridgeshire, in the county of Cambridgeshire. It was introduced in September 2006 and is an active postcode. CB22 3EQ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
CB22 3EQ is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of CB22 3EQ as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Rural white-collar workers.
The closest road name to CB22 3EQ is Mill Farm Lane which is centered 49 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Sawston Bypass and is 169 m away. The closest railway station is Whittlesford Parkway Rail Station, 700 m away.
The closest primary school to CB22 3EQ (for ages 11 and under) is William Westley Church of England VC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on July 9, 2019.
The local pub for residents of CB22 3EQ is The John Barleycorn and is 1.61 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 8,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Domino's Pizza and is 1.28 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on November 26, 2020.
Residents reported an average download speed of 39.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 7.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for CB22 3EQ is covered by the Cambridgeshire police force association and Cambridgesh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
